Morwenna Lasko & Jay Pun defy the boundaries of acoustic music. Hailing
from Charlottesville, VA, this duo has more raw talent and natural style than
you ever thought was possible. Infusing style from World, Jazz, Folk, Funk, and many more that it's almost impossible to mention here. This duo is far beyond any type of group that's out right now.
Currently hard at work on their sophomore effort, 2008 will definitely be a year to remember. The duo is working to bring more of their band sound but still remaining true to all of their influences. Don't be out of the loop and make sure you know what's up with this incredible duo.

With the release of their debut album, Etopia, Morwenna and
Jay put together their individual unique sounds and have found their collective
groove. These gifted musicians will take your breath away and leave you begging
for more.
Together they have shared shows with such great acts as Bela Fleck & The Flecktones, Frank Vignola Quintet
, Darol Anger, Corey Harris,
RobinElla, Dave Matthews Band,
Hackensaw Boys, Avett Brothers, Dr. Ralph Stanley, to name a few.
